Multi-Step Word Problems

Solve in steps. Each problem needs two operations.

  1. 1.
    Lily had 6 coins, got 36 more, then gave away 33. How many coins does Lily have now?
  2. 2.
    Noah filled 3 bins with 4 seeds each, then added 79 loose seeds. How many seeds in total?
  3. 3.
    Iris collected 5 pencils a day for 3 days, then lost 6. How many pencils remain?
  4. 4.
    Lucas collected 4 cards a day for 4 days, then lost 4. How many cards remain?
  5. 5.
    Kai filled 4 jars with 6 coins each, then added 7 loose coins. How many coins in total?
  6. 6.
    Lucas filled 5 jars with 2 berries each, then added 62 loose berries. How many berries in total?
  7. 7.
    Kai collected 9 cookies a day for 3 days, then lost 14. How many cookies remain?
  8. 8.
    Cleo collected 9 stickers a day for 3 days, then lost 17. How many stickers remain?
  9. 9.
    Ruby had 46 pencils, got 92 more, then gave away 122. How many pencils does Ruby have now?
  10. 10.
    Finn collected 12 apples a day for 2 days, then lost 3. How many apples remain?
  11. 11.
    Sofia filled 2 bags with 4 balloons each, then added 63 loose balloons. How many balloons in total?
  12. 12.
    Kai filled 2 bags with 2 beads each, then added 1 loose beads. How many beads in total?
